    Berbeda dengan hukum internasional yang mengatur hubungan antarnegara, Hukum Indonesia adalah sistem hukum nasional yang berlaku di dalam wilayah kedaulatan Republik Indonesia.

    Sistem hukum kita unik karena merupakan campuran (pluralisme) dari sistem Hukum Sipil (Civil Law), Hukum Adat, dan Hukum Islam.

    1. Sumber Hukum dan Hierarki Peraturan

    Di Indonesia, peraturan memiliki tingkatan. Peraturan yang lebih rendah tidak boleh bertentangan dengan peraturan yang lebih tinggi. Berdasarkan UU No. 12 Tahun 2011, hierarkinya adalah:

    UUD 1945: Hukum dasar tertulis tertinggi.

    Ketetapan MPR (Tap MPR).

    Undang-Undang (UU) / Peraturan Pemerintah Pengganti UU (Perppu).

    Peraturan Pemerintah (PP): Untuk menjalankan UU.

    Peraturan Presiden (Perpres).

    Peraturan Daerah (Perda) Provinsi.

    Peraturan Daerah (Perda) Kabupaten/Kota.

    2. Penggolongan Hukum di Indonesia

    Secara garis besar, hukum di Indonesia dibagi menjadi dua ranah utama:

    A. Hukum Publik

    Mengatur hubungan antara warga negara dengan negara (kepentingan umum).

    Hukum Tata Negara: Mengatur struktur organisasi negara.

    Hukum Administrasi Negara: Mengatur tata cara birokrasi dan aparatur sipil.

    Hukum Pidana: Mengatur perbuatan yang dilarang dan sanksinya (termuat dalam KUHP).

    B. Hukum Privat (Perdata)

    Mengatur hubungan antarindividu (kepentingan pribadi).

    Hukum Perdata: Masalah waris, perkawinan, utang-piutang, dan kontrak (termuat dalam KUHPer).

    Hukum Dagang: Mengatur urusan bisnis dan perniagaan.

    3. Lembaga Peradilan (Kekuasaan Kehakiman)

    Untuk menegakkan hukum, Indonesia memiliki beberapa lembaga peradilan di bawah Mahkamah Agung dan satu lembaga khusus:

    Peradilan Umum: Menangani kasus pidana dan perdata (Pengadilan Negeri & Tinggi).

    Peradilan Agama: Khusus untuk warga Muslim (perkawinan, waris, hibah).

    Peradilan Tata Usaha Negara (PTUN): Menangani sengketa melawan keputusan pejabat pemerintah.

    Peradilan Militer: Khusus untuk anggota TNI.

    Mahkamah Konstitusi (MK): Lembaga independen yang bertugas menguji apakah sebuah UU bertentangan dengan UUD 1945.

    4. Unsur Pluralisme Hukum

    Salah satu ciri khas hukum Indonesia adalah pengakuan terhadap:

    Hukum Adat: Aturan tidak tertulis yang hidup di masyarakat adat tertentu (diakui sepanjang tidak bertentangan dengan kepentingan nasional).

    Hukum Islam: Diterapkan secara formal dalam hukum keluarga (melalui Pengadilan Agama) dan ekonomi syariah.

    Fun Fact: Indonesia saat ini sedang dalam masa transisi menggunakan KUHP Baru (UU No. 1 Tahun 2023) yang akan mulai berlaku efektif secara menyeluruh pada tahun 2026 untuk menggantikan KUHP peninggalan kolonial Belanda.

    The social determinates of health include factors other than access to health care, such as socioeconomic status, economic stability, access to quality education, physical environment, support networks, employment, etc. Although efforts to improve healthcare within the United States usually point to responsibilities within the healthcare system, there is a growing recognition that these social determinants of health are also criticalfrom the individual to the population level.

    Health education is any combination of learning experiences designed to help people in a community improve their health by increasing their knowledge or influencing their attitudes (WHO, n.d.). Education is key to health promotion, disease prevention, and disaster preparedness. The health indicator framework identified in Healthy People 2030 prompts action in health services accessibility, clinical preventive services, environmental quality, injury or violence prevention, maternal, infant, and child health, mental health, nutrition, substance abuse prevention, and tobacco use cessation or prevention.

    Nurses provide accurate evidence-based information and education in formal and informal settings. They draw upon evidence-based practice to provide health promotion and disease prevention activities to create social and physical environments that are conducive to improving and maintaining community health. When provided with the tools to be successful, people demonstrate lifestyle changes (self-care) that promote health and help reduce readmissions. They are better able to tolerate stressors, including environmental changes, and enjoy a better quality of life. Also, in times of crisis, a resilient community is a safer community (Flanders, 2018; Office of Disease Prevention and Health Promotion, n.d.).
